About Jamangile Senior Secondary School

Jamangile Senior Secondary School functions as a public secondary school in Maclear, Eastern Cape, falling within the Joe Gqabi education district. The school recorded 771 learners and 26 educators for the 2025 academic year, giving a learner-to-educator ratio of 30:1. As a Quintile 2 school, it receives a high per-learner government funding allocation.

Governance & Funding

Quintile Classification

Jamangile Senior Secondary School is classified as a Q2 school, which means it serves communities with very high poverty levels and receives substantial government funding.

Fee Status

As a Q2 institution, Jamangile Senior Secondary School is designated as a no-fee school. Parents and guardians are not required to pay school fees, ensuring that financial circumstances do not bar learners from accessing quality education.

Section 21 Status

Jamangile Senior Secondary School is a Section 21 school, meaning the School Governing Body (SGB) manages its own budget. This financial autonomy allows the school to make independent decisions regarding its operational needs without direct provincial administration.

History & Background

Jamangile Senior Secondary School was historically administered under the Transkei education department. The Transkei Department of Education was one of the former homeland education systems before South Africa's democratic transition in 1994. Today, the school operates as a non-discriminatory public institution under the Eastern Cape Department of Education.
